How they compare

Poland currently reports 391,279 constant 2015 US$ per square kilometre against 359,281 constant 2015 US$ per square kilometre in India, a difference of 31,998 constant 2015 US$ per square kilometre.

That makes Poland's figure about 1.1 times India's.

Across all 29 years both countries report, Poland has been ahead every year.

India ranks 44th and Poland ranks 42nd of 160 countries.

Poland has averaged higher in every one of the 4 decades both report.

Head to head by decade

Decade India Poland Difference Ahead
1990s 49,310 constant 2015 US$ per square kilometre 149,070 constant 2015 US$ per square kilometre 99,761 constant 2015 US$ per square kilometre Poland
2000s 104,409 constant 2015 US$ per square kilometre 203,386 constant 2015 US$ per square kilometre 98,978 constant 2015 US$ per square kilometre Poland
2010s 236,426 constant 2015 US$ per square kilometre 319,112 constant 2015 US$ per square kilometre 82,686 constant 2015 US$ per square kilometre Poland
2020s 316,012 constant 2015 US$ per square kilometre 415,212 constant 2015 US$ per square kilometre 99,200 constant 2015 US$ per square kilometre Poland

Averages of every year both report within each decade.
